This commit is contained in:
YeMingfei666 2025-01-14 17:20:29 +08:00
commit 092b040b5f
1 changed files with 9 additions and 18 deletions

View File

@ -74,9 +74,10 @@
useCommonStore useCommonStore
} from '@/store/common.js' } from '@/store/common.js'
const $common = useCommonStore() const $common = useCommonStore()
import { selectUserMoney, selectPayDetails, canCash, state, withdraw } from '@/api/me/withdraw.js'; import { state } from '@/api/me/withdraw.js';
import { import {
reactive, reactive,
ref,
getCurrentInstance, getCurrentInstance,
nextTick nextTick
} from "vue"; } from "vue";
@ -115,31 +116,21 @@
}) })
onReady(() => { onReady(() => {
nextTick(()=>{ nextTick(()=>{
data.adRewardedVideoloadNum = 0 datas.adRewardedVideoloadNum = 0
adRewarded.value.load(); adRewarded.value.load();
}) })
getCanCash()
}) })
/**
* 获取看广告状态
*/
async function getCanCash() {
canCash().then(res => {
data.isWithdraw = !res;
})
}
/** /**
* 广告加载失败回调 * 广告加载失败回调
* @param {Object} e * @param {Object} e
*/ */
function onaderror(e) { function onaderror(e) {
if ( data.adRewardedVideoloadNum >=3 ) { if ( datas.adRewardedVideoloadNum >=3 ) {
data.adRewardedShow = false; datas.adRewardedShow = false;
return return
} }
data.adRewardedVideoloadNum++ datas.adRewardedVideoloadNum++
setTimeout(() => { setTimeout(() => {
adRewarded.value.load(); adRewarded.value.load();
}, 1000); // 10 }, 1000); // 10
@ -151,7 +142,7 @@
* @param {Object} e * @param {Object} e
*/ */
function onadload(e) { function onadload(e) {
data.adRewardedShow = true; datas.adRewardedShow = true;
console.log('广告数据加载成功'); console.log('广告数据加载成功');
} }
/** /**
@ -163,9 +154,8 @@
if (detail && detail.isEnded) { if (detail && detail.isEnded) {
// //
let res = await state({ let res = await state({
extraKey: data.urlCallback.extra extraKey: datas.urlCallback.extra
}) })
getCanCash()
} else { } else {
// 退 // 退
} }
@ -253,6 +243,7 @@
// //
async function getTaskdata() { async function getTaskdata() {
let res = await selectTaskCenter() let res = await selectTaskCenter()
console.log(!datas.isExamine)
if (!datas.isExamine) { if (!datas.isExamine) {
let arrData = [] let arrData = []
res.forEach(ele => { res.forEach(ele => {